Grasping the Power of Power BI: Why Start a Dashboard?
So, why bother learning how to start a Power BI dashboard, anyway? The answer is simple: data visualization is powerful. In today's world, data is everywhere, and Power BI is your trusty sidekick for making sense of it. A Power BI dashboard transforms complex data into easy-to-understand visuals, like charts, graphs, and maps. This lets you spot trends, identify patterns, and make smarter decisions based on real insights. Instead of drowning in spreadsheets, you get a clear, concise view of your data. For example, imagine you're running a small business. A Power BI dashboard can track your sales, customer behavior, and marketing efforts all in one place. You can instantly see which products are popular, which marketing campaigns are effective, and where you might need to adjust your strategy. It’s like having a crystal ball for your business! This kind of insight isn't just for big corporations; it's accessible to anyone with data to analyze. Moreover, Power BI is interactive. You can click on charts, filter data, and drill down into details to get a deeper understanding. This interactivity makes the data exploration process engaging and allows you to ask and answer your own questions. With a well-designed dashboard, you can monitor performance, track key metrics, and communicate your findings in a visually appealing and effective way. The Benefits of Using Power BI
Power BI offers a ton of benefits that make it a go-to tool for data analysis and visualization. Firstly, it’s incredibly user-friendly. The interface is intuitive, and you don’t need to be a coding whiz to create stunning dashboards. Microsoft designed Power BI to be accessible to users of all skill levels, making data analysis less intimidating. Secondly, Power BI seamlessly integrates with various data sources. You can pull data from Excel spreadsheets, databases, cloud services, and much more. This flexibility means you can connect to almost any data you need, allowing you to create comprehensive and unified dashboards. Another significant advantage is the ability to share and collaborate. You can easily publish your dashboards online and share them with colleagues, clients, or anyone else. Power BI also supports real-time data updates, ensuring that your dashboards are always current. This feature is invaluable for monitoring live data, such as website traffic, stock prices, or sales figures. Additionally, Power BI offers a wide range of visualization options. You can choose from dozens of chart types, including bar charts, line graphs, pie charts, maps, and many more. The platform allows for customization, enabling you to tailor your visuals to meet your specific needs and preferences. Ultimately, these benefits combine to empower you to turn data into actionable insights, helping you make data-driven decisions confidently and efficiently. Setting Up Your Power BI Environment
Okay, let's get you set up to learn how to start a Power BI dashboard! Before you dive into creating dashboards, you need to get Power BI installed and ready to go. Don't worry, the setup is straightforward. First off, head over to the Microsoft website and download Power BI Desktop. It’s free and available for both Windows and Mac. Install it on your computer; it's pretty much like installing any other software. Once installed, launch Power BI Desktop. You’ll be greeted with the Power BI interface. The first time you open it, you might see some welcome screens and prompts, but you can usually close those to get to the main workspace. Now, you need to sign in or create an account. If you have a Microsoft account (like an Outlook or Hotmail email), you can use that to sign in. If you don't have an account, you can create one during the sign-in process. This account is essential for accessing the Power BI service, where you'll be able to share and publish your dashboards. After signing in, take a moment to familiarize yourself with the interface. You'll see the ribbon at the top, which has all sorts of options for formatting and working with your data. On the left, you'll find the report view, the data view, and the model view. These are the different areas where you'll build your dashboards, transform your data, and manage your data relationships. At this stage, your Power BI environment is all set. You can now connect to your data sources, import data, and start building your first dashboard.
